Totoro Decal
Nov. 15, 2024
My Neighbor Totoro Studio Ghibli Anime Car Window Decal Sticker 009 Anime Stickery Online Totoro Decal Sticker | Custom Made In the USA | Fast Shipping Totoro Rain Drops, My Neighbor Totoro-inspired Vinyl Car/Laptop Decal – Decal Drama Totoro Decal